    Yet Another Stevens Pass TR (4/10/07)

    What can you say about a day like this in April? Uhhh, it snowed last night?

    Lots of the exposed ridges had obviously visible refrozen slush that was pretty scoured. Some places had some crunchy stuff cleverly hidden under an inch or two of fresh. Still, if you looked, there was some sweet, sweet snow to be had...

    Seventh Heaven was a good place to be. Like a really, really good place to be...
